#706de3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#706de3 is composed of 43.9% red, 42.7%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 241.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 65.9%. #706de3 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0daff with #0000c7.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#706de3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#706de3 has RGB values of R:112, G:109,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7368163.

Shades and Tints of #706de3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#706de3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3ad is the less saturated color, while #5752fe is the most saturated one.
